(Refer to page 165) Answer Chilaiditi’s sign and Chilaiditi’s syndrome Chilaiditi’s sign is defined by the asymptomatic interposition of part of the intestine (commonly the hepatic flexure of the colon) between the right hemi-diaphragm and the liver. It is usually an incidental finding. When symptomatic, it is referred to as the Chilaiditi’s syndrome. Presentations may range from intermittent recurrent mild abdominal pain to acute intestinal volvulus, though the symptoms reported so far have been inconsistent between different patients and can be nonspecific.
